Overview
If you worked for multiple employers and contributed more than the maximum allowable amount to Massachusetts Paid Family and Medical Leave (PFML) in a tax year, you may be eligible for a refund of the excess contributions. To report this and claim a potential refund, you must complete the MA – Excess Paid Family and Medical Leave Contributions form on your Massachusetts return.
Generally, you should complete this form if:
- You had PFML contributions withheld by more than one employer, and
- The total amount withheld exceeds the annual limit set by the Massachusetts Department of Revenue.
This situation most commonly applies to taxpayers with multiple jobs or who changed employers during the tax year.
Add PFML Contributions
To add the PFML Contributions:
- Go to State Taxes.
- Click I’d like to see the forms I’ve filled out or search for a form.
- Select Massachusetts.
- Click on the General tab.
- Click on MA – Excess Paid Family and Medical Leave Contributions to add and open the form.
- Enter your information and click Save.
Further Information
The annual maximum for PFML contributions is determined by Massachusetts law and may change yearly. You can confirm the current thresholds by reviewing the Massachusetts Form 1 Instructions.
